syl20bnr ebe4c60264 Revert "Defer packages by default using use-package-always-defer"
This reverts commit 29c78ce841 and all other fixes
that have been made afterwards.

The motivation is that use-package is seen by many as a replacement for
`require`. Is use-package always defer the loading of packages then is breaks
this use case, this does not respect POLA so even if it was making Spacemacs
loading faster (up to 3s faster on some startup on my machine) we just cannot
use it, it would be irresponsible. Spacemacs should be easy to use, loading
performance will come with time but it is not a priority.

spacemacs-editing layer

Description

This layer adds packages to improve editing with Spacemacs.

Features:

  • Support for automatic indentation of code via aggressive-indent.
  • Support for jumping to chars using a decision tree via avy.
  • Improvements for evaluating sexps via eval-sexp-fu.
  • Selecting and editing of multiple text elements via expand-region.
  • Support for editing files in hex format via hexl.
  • Deletion of consecutive horizontal whitespace with a single key via hungry-delete.
  • Support for selecting and opening links using avy via link-hint.
  • Adding of sample text via lorem-ipsum.
  • Transient state for moving text via move-text.
  • Support for folding of code via origami.
  • Support for password generation via password-generator.
  • Support for improving parenthesis handling via smartparens.
  • Automatic whitespace cleanup on save via spacemacs-whitespace-cleanup.
  • Support for converting definitions to certain styles via string-inflection.
  • Support for generating UUIDs via uuidgen.
